Bexar County Commissioner Rebeca Clay-Flores revealed her colon cancer diagnosis and commitment to preventative health access.
Bexar County Commissioner Rebeca Clay-Flores announced Tuesday that she's undergoing treatment for colon cancer . Clay-Flores said that after months of feeling unwell, doctor appointments and labs, she was diagnosed before the start of early voting for the Nov. 5, 2024 election. While I kept smiling for pictures on social media and working with constituents, at the forefront of my mind was the fact that not only did I have a large tumor in my colon, but it was bleeding, the Democrat said.
Clay-Flores, whose Precinct 1 sweeps from the county's South to Far West sides, described campaigning in the last grueling weeks of her general-election campaign against Republican challenger Lina Prado. The commissioner won the November race with 63% of the vote, and was sworn in last week to her second four-year term. She said she underwent a six-hour surgery and spent five days recovering at Bexar County-owned University Hospital, and that the experience reaffirmed her commitment to advocating for preventative health access. When I asked my GI doc if I had any risk factors, he said only your race, Clay-Flores said. So if you're in your 40s and Black, you have a high risk.
